Understanding 250cc Trikes
250cc trikes combine the essence of motorcycles with the stability of three wheels. Unlike two-wheeled motorcycles, trikes provide added safety and comfort, especially for new riders or those seeking a more stable ride. Their versatility allows them to be used for various purposes, from leisurely rides to daily commuting.
Benefits of Riding a 250cc Trike
-
Stability and Safety: The three-wheel design reduces the risk of tipping over, making it a safer option for riders of all levels.
-
Comfort: Many trikes come equipped with comfortable seats and ergonomic designs, providing a more enjoyable riding experience.
-
Storage Options: Trikes often feature built-in storage compartments, allowing riders to carry more gear than traditional motorcycles.
-
Fuel Efficiency: With a 250cc engine, trikes offer excellent fuel efficiency, making them cost-effective for daily commuting.
-
Variety of Styles: From chopper-style designs to practical scooters, there’s a 250cc trike for every taste and need.

Choosing the Right 250cc Trike
When selecting the perfect 250cc trike for your needs, consider the following factors:
Intended Use
Identify how you plan to use your trike. For daily commuting, a lighter trike with good fuel efficiency may be ideal. Conversely, if you seek adventure, an off-road model is the way to go.
Engine Performance
The engine type and performance are crucial. Look for trikes with a good balance of power and efficiency. A 250cc engine generally provides ample power for city and highway riding.
Comfort and Ergonomics
Ensure that the trike you choose offers a comfortable riding position and adequate seating. Test rides are recommended to gauge comfort levels.
Features and Accessories
Consider any additional features that may enhance your riding experience, such as storage options, safety features, and customization possibilities.
Price and Budget
Prices for 250cc trikes can vary significantly. Set a budget and explore options within that range. Don’t forget to factor in insurance and maintenance costs.

FAQ
What is a 250cc trike?
A 250cc trike is a three-wheeled vehicle powered by a 250cc engine, combining the features of motorcycles and scooters. It offers enhanced stability, comfort, and storage compared to traditional two-wheelers.
What are the advantages of riding a trike?
Trikes provide greater stability, comfort, and storage capacity than motorcycles. They are easier to handle and offer a safer riding experience, especially for beginners.
Can I use a 250cc trike for daily commuting?
Yes, many 250cc trikes are designed for daily commuting, offering good fuel efficiency, comfort, and practicality for city riding.
How fast can a 250cc trike go?
Most 250cc trikes can reach speeds between 50 to 65 mph, depending on the model and engine performance.
Do 250cc trikes require a special license?
Licensing requirements vary by location. Many regions require a motorcycle endorsement or a special trike license, so check local regulations before riding.
What maintenance do 250cc trikes need?
Regular maintenance includes oil changes, tire checks, brake inspections, and overall servicing to ensure safe and efficient operation.
